**Job Summary:**
Raytheon Intelligence & Space, Vision Systems (RVS) Systems Integration and Test Department is seeking an experienced Senior Test & Integration System Engineer with expertise in airborne electro-optical and infrared (EO/IR) surveillance and targeting sensor systems.
This position is an onsite role at out Goleta, CA Facility.
This is a third shift position.
**What Will You Do:**
You will support a multi-disciplinary engineering team completed tasks such as planning, development of optical/EM/and trade studies, performance analysis.
You will perform integration, verification and validation testing to support delivery of a new EO/IR Sensor Systems.
You will support execution and procurement activities in support of an engineering build.
You will collaborate with operations and manufacturing teams.
**Qualifications You Must Have:**
+ Typically requires a minimum of 5 years of experience to include airborne and, or space EOIR system test, integration verification and validation testing, product transition to production or relatable experience.
+ Experience performing and executing test methodology within an E/O system.
+ Experience in test methodology within sensors to include optical performance, analysis, and test verification for EO/IR sensor systems and/or relatable experience in development and production program.
+ The ability to obtain and maintain a U.S. government issued security clearance is required. U.S. citizenship is required, as only U.S. citizens are eligible for a security clearance
**Qualifications We Prefer:**
+ Experience with requirements test development, test analysis, derivations, verification and test validation.
+ Experience developing and, or executing factory test plans, procedures, and equipment to support an EO/IR sensor system or relatable system.
+ Analytical capabilities, or an ability to relate observed phenomenon back to first principals
+ Excellent communication skills (written, verbal, and presentation) and be able to effectively communicate with Test Management, IPT leaders, hardware and software development engineers, specialty engineers, program managers, and customers.
+ Prior experience with ROIC wafer probing, fabrication, integration, verification, and validation for a complex EO/IR system.
+ Experience with basic scripting and/or software development (MATLAB, C++/C# preferred)
+ Experience with LabView or other SW package to control laboratory equipment and operation of sensors
